## Environments: branch-sweeper

The stale-branch cleanup bot runs in three environments (dev, staging, prod), each with its own grace period and dry-run flag. Reviewers should confirm that staging mirrors prod except for the notification channel, since a mismatch there caused last quarter's accidental sweep. The current staging configuration is as follows.

config for bagep-kageg:
ULADOR_LOG_LEVEL=warn
ULADOR_METRICS_HOST=metrics.ulador.tolvaqcorp.corp
ULADOR_POOL_SIZE=32

Wiki: Moving master copies to the print shop

Heads-up for the driver's coordinator: master copies headed to Quillborne Print are originals — there are no backups, so treat every run like it matters. Masters travel in the grey rigid folders, sealed with a dated tab by whoever signs them out. One run, one driver, no combining with other jobs. Keep them flat, keep them dry, and log departure and arrival times. The confidential hand-over instruction for the courier is below.

handover note for yagef-bagep: the drudor pelius courier leaves the kasdor zorvan norir ledger at gate 8016 under passcode 755406

Plugin authors load-testing the Merrow checkout flow should target the dedicated perf environment, never staging, since staging shares a payment stub with other teams. Keep virtual-user ramps under five minutes and record baseline latency before each run. Your harness reads its configuration from a local env file, and the perf-gateway credential belongs on the line immediately below.

vault entry, kafog-yahop: COURIER_KEY8=0faa53ae

## tailctl: follow mode fixes

This PR fixes dropped lines in tailctl's follow mode when the Brindlemoor aggregator rotates files mid-read. We now track inodes and reopen on rotation. New team members: tailctl is our internal log-tailing CLI; see the onboarding wiki for setup. Backoff and buffer behavior are governed by the constants defined below.

constants for tafog-kahag:
RATE_LIMITS = {
    "sorir": 697,
    "oliox": 683,
    "holax": 176,
    "casox": 60,
    "pelius": 382,
}